there were 936,795 bankruptcy filings in 2018. If there were 310,061 chapter 13 filings, what percent were not chapter 13

66.90% of the total bankruptcy fillings are not chapter 13 fillings.

What is bankruptcy?

This is a situation where the management of a company declares that it could no longer pay its debt obligations as it does have the cash resources to do so.

In this case, the total number of bankruptcy fillings is 936,795, out of which 310,061 are chapter 13 filings

fillings that were not chapter 13=936,795-310,061

fillings that were not chapter 13=626,734

fillings that were not chapter 13 as % of total fillings=626,734/936,795

fillings that were not chapter 13 as % of total fillings=66.90%

Chris has a six sided die. Create a sample
Klio2033 [76]

Answer:

Sample space: {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6}

Simple event

Step-by-step explanation:

Sample space is a list of all the possible outcomes.

This is a simple event because you are only doing one event, such as rolling a die.

A compound event would be multiple simple events, such as flipping a coin <em>and </em>choosing a marble from a bag.
